Did you know coral reefs cover less than 1% of the ocean but support 25% of sea life? Coral reefs are found in warm ocean waters all over the world. These colourful reefs act like underwater cities where fish, turtles, and even sharks live together. Coral reefs are important because they are home to many ocean plants and animals. They also help keep the sea clean. Moreover, they provide food, jobs and a special place to visit for millions of people all over the world.
Coral reefs are formed by tiny animals called coral polyps. Imagine thousands of tiny coral polyps working like builders to create giant reefs over centuries! When coral reefs are healthy, they keep the ocean environment balanced. Sadly, pollution and climate change are damaging the corals, turning them white and weak. And many things that humans do are making the reefs sick. Some reefs are even starting to die. If reefs disappear (消失), the ocean's balance could break down, affecting all sea life.
We should protect coral reefs and help them become healthy again. Even small actions, like using less plastic, can make a big difference for reefs. Schools and scientists are now planting new corals to help damaged reefs recover. Let's be reef heroes by learning and sharing how to protect this underwater wonder!
